[quote=Anonymous]Hi there, OP. I think you quit when you've had enough. I was in a similar boat: easy natural pregnancy with my son, but then #2 was very hard. Even three rounds of PGS-tested donor eggs didn't work. I switched clinics to Sher in NY, and I finally got pregnant on the 4th DE try. But that was going to be the last try. I'm really thrilled to have our daughter now. But I also think I realize now that just having my son would have been fine. It *is* harder to have a baby -- especially with an older kid in the picture -- when you are older: harder on your body, hard on your career to be out again for a while. I love her a lot, and I am glad that she and my son will have each other (as long as they don't grow up hating each other, which I will try very hard to prevent). But it would have been OK the other way -- even though I couldn't see it at the time. [/quote]
